Planning Commission hears update, months of public comment on Bicycle Plan EIR and injunction
Summary
The Planning Commission heard a department update and wide public comment on the Bicycle Plan EIR after a court ordered an environmental review and issued an injunction blocking construction of new bike facilities. Staff outlined an accelerated schedule for a draft EIR and said lifting the injunction depends on certification of the final EIR.
The San Francisco Planning Commission on Aug. 14 heard a detailed update from department staff on the citywide Bicycle Plan environmental impact report and an injunction the courts have placed on implementing bicycle facilities.
Director (planning department) told the commission the superior court had ordered an EIR for the Bicycle Plan and issued an injunction preventing construction of any bicycle facilities until the city completes that review.
